Output 24e0371167d0429f428c5f920a119fe7a1dc229ddbbfbc726da4a74f346eefaa:0

value
249466
script pubkey
OP_0 OP_PUSHBYTES_20 57e01b59418f11dc158b15a403489dfc31af30bd
address
bc1q2lspkk2p3ugac9vtzkjqxjyalsc67v9a3h904g
transaction
24e0371167d0429f428c5f920a119fe7a1dc229ddbbfbc726da4a74f346eefaa
confirmations
250659
spent
true